Yemen’s Houthis ready to attack Israel if war on Gaza resumes, leader says
Yemen’s Houthis, who control most of western Yemen, including the capital, are ready to launch attacks on Israel if it resumes its war on Gaza and does not commit to the ceasefire, the group’s leader, Abdel-Malik al-Houthi, said in a televised speech according to Al Jazeera.
Before the truce, the Houthis had attacked Israeli and other vessels in the Red Sea, disturbing global shipping lanes, in what they said were acts of solidarity with Palestinians in Gaza during Israel’s war with Hamas.
